Off-site Description:

Serves as the project manager for a large, complex task order (or a group of task orders affecting the same system) and shall assist the Program Manager in working with the Government Contracting Officer (KO), the task order-level Task Order Managers, government management personnel, and customer agency representatives. Under the guidance of the Program Manager, responsible for the overall management of the specific task order(s) and ensuring that the technical solutions and schedules in the task order are implemented in a timely manner. Minimum Requirements: Project Management certification (PMP) 5+ years relevant experience 5+ years of leadership experience with progressively higher responsibility in the public and/or private sector in the IT and/or consulting fields BS/BA or four (4) years of related experience Current IAM Level III (CISSP) Current DoD secret security clearance, Tier 2 (T2) We are an Equal Employment Opportunity / Affirmative Action employer, and all qualified applicants will receive consideration for employment without regard to sex, protected veteran status, marital status, genetic information, or any other characteristic protected by law.
